Balsamic Roasted Mushroom
Catherine Barclay
Balsamic roasted mushrooms offer a healthy alternative to oil-based roasted mushrooms. This recipe involves marinating fresh mushrooms in balsamic vinegar and seasoning them with herbs before roasting. The result is a flavorful, tender, and slightly caramelized dish that's perfect as a side or topping for various meals.
Course Side Dish
Cuisine American
Servings 4 people
Calories 35 kcal
- 3 cups button mushrooms
- 3 tbsp balsamic vinegar
- 2 tbsp soy sauce select the low salt version
- 3 cloves garlic minced
- ½ tsp fresh thyme chopped
Preheat oven at 200℃ (400℉)
In a large bowl, oss the mushrooms into the other ingredients.
Line an oven-roasting pan and arrange mushrooms in a single layer.
Roast until soft, around 15 - 20 minutes. Baste halfway through and if dry, add a little water to the base of the pan.
Serve as a side dish or on top of your favourite plant-based meal.
